Bowling at Bowlero typically costs between $30 and $60 per hour per lane, with per-person pricing ranging from $8 to $18 depending on location, time of day, and day of the week. Specials, packages, and peak hours can affect final pricing.

Typical Cost Breakdown at Bowlero (2025)

Below is a detailed breakdown of average prices across multiple Bowlero locations in major U.S. cities as of October 2025.

City Weekday Off-Peak (per hour) Weekday Peak (per hour) Weekend (per hour) Per Person (Shoe Included) Shoe Rental
New York, NY $38 $58 $65 $16–$20 $5.50
Los Angeles, CA $35 $55 $62 $15–$19 $5.00
Chicago, IL $32 $50 $58 $14–$18 $4.50
Dallas, TX $30 $48 $55 $12–$16 $4.00
Miami, FL $34 $52 $60 $14–$18 $5.00
Table data source:1, 2

The data shows a clear trend: urban locations like New York and Los Angeles command premium rates, especially during peak and weekend hours. Off-peak weekday bowling can save groups up to 40% compared to weekend evenings. Per-person deals often bundle shoe rental and one game, making them cost-effective for individuals or small groups.

Frequently Asked Questions About Bowlero Pricing

How much does it cost to bowl at Bowlero per person?

On average, it costs between $12 and $18 per person for one game with shoe rental. During happy hour or special promotions, prices can drop to $10 or less.

How much is an hour of bowling at Bowlero?

Hourly lane rates range from $30 to $65 depending on time and location. Weekday off-peak hours start around $30, while weekend evenings can reach $65 in major cities.

Does Bowlero charge per game or per hour?

Bowlero primarily charges by the hour per lane, but they also offer per-person pricing during promotions. One game typically lasts about 10 minutes per player, so a 1-hour block fits 3–4 games for a group of 4–6 people.

Is shoe rental included in Bowlero prices?

Shoe rental is not always included. Standard walk-in prices require separate payment ($4–$6). However, most per-person deals and online packages include shoe rental.

Can I book Bowlero lanes online and save money?

Yes, booking online through the Bowlero website or app often provides discounts of 10%–15%, especially for advance reservations. Online booking also guarantees lane availability and allows you to pre-pay and skip lines.

Final Tips for Saving Money at Bowlero

To maximize value, consider bowling during weekday afternoons, taking advantage of happy hour deals, and booking online. Large groups should compare per-lane hourly rates versus per-person packages to find the best deal. Always check the local Bowlero location's website for real-time pricing and current promotions.
